HANDOVER NOTE — Heads of Department

Passing the baton on the Meridix division hiring freeze. Quick version: we paused all external hires in June after the Corvane contract slipped; internal transfers are still fine with my sign-off (soon yours). Jonas Pellwright keeps the exceptions list. Expect pressure from the Tarnley team — hold the line until Q2. The reasoning behind the timing is captured in the note below.

board note of fahag-tajop: The eastern region missed its Julix quota by 44.0 percent last quarter. Ralionax Holdings plans to lower the Druath list price by 61.8 percent in March. The board signed off on a budget of $295.0 million for Project Gilath. The renewal with Ruswynix Systems closes at $274.5 million a year, 17.0 percent above the last contract.

Account recovery for Millwheel Bakery's ordering portal must respect the 2 p.m. order-cutoff rule: restored accounts cannot modify same-day orders after cutoff. Code reviewer should confirm the guard sits in the recovery service, not the UI. After the guard check passes, re-enable the account vault with the recovery passphrase below.

vault phrase of tajef-tafog = istox-sorax-zorox-casok-holox-kelix-weneth-drueth-casion

Ticket: Staging env misconfigured for Siftgate bloom filter

The bloom layer in front of the Pellet KV store is rejecting all lookups in staging because the env file was copied from the dev template without credentials. False-positive tuning values are fine; only the auth line is missing. To unblock the weekly demo, the Pellet admission secret must be set on the following line.

env line for yaguf-fajop: LEDGER_TOKEN13=fb08984397349